4But he aunswered, and sayde, it is written: Man shall not lyue by breade only, but by euery worde that proceadeth out of the mouth of God.
5Then the deuyll taketh hym vp into the holy citie, and setteth hym on a pinacle of the temple,
6And saith vnto hym: If thou be the sonne of God, cast thy selfe downe. For it is written: He shall geue his Angels charge ouer thee, & with their handes they shall lyft thee vp, lest at any tyme thou dashe thy foote agaynst a stone.
7And Iesus sayde to hym. It is written agayne: Thou shalt not tempt the Lorde thy God.
8Agayne, the deuyll taketh hym vp, into an exceadyng hye mountayne, and sheweth hym all the kyngdomes of the worlde, and the glorie of them,
9And sayth vnto hym: All these wyll I geue thee, yf thou wylt fall downe, and worshyp me.
10The sayth Iesus vnto hym: Auoyde Sathan. For it is written: Thou shalt worshyp the Lorde thy God, and hym only shalt thou serue.
11Then the deuyll leaueth him, and beholde, the Angels came, and ministred vnto hym.
1Then was Iesus ledde away of the spirite into wyldernesse, to be tempted of the deuyll.
2And when he had fasted fourtie dayes, and fourtie nightes, he was afterwarde an hungred.
